2-Hydroxypropyl oleate

ADVERTISEMENT
Identification
Molecular formula
C21H40O3
CAS number
7727-70-4
IUPAC name
2-hydroxypropyl octadec-9-enoate
State
State

At room temperature, 2-hydroxypropyl oleate is typically a liquid due to its nature as an ester of a fatty acid. It retains its liquid state across a range of room temperatures.

Melting point (Celsius)
-20.00
Melting point (Kelvin)
253.15
Boiling point (Celsius)
324.80
Boiling point (Kelvin)
598.00
General information
Molecular weight
328.54g/mol
Molar mass
326.5390g/mol
Density
0.8912g/cm3
Appearence

2-Hydroxypropyl oleate is a colorless to light yellow viscous liquid. It is a synthetic ester derived from oleic acid, which is a naturally occurring fatty acid, and 2-hydroxypropanol. Its viscosity lends it to a variety of applications in personal care products and cosmetics.

Comment on solubility

Solubility of 2-hydroxypropyl octadec-9-enoate

2-hydroxypropyl octadec-9-enoate, a derivative of fatty acids, presents interesting solubility characteristics due to its unique structure. The presence of both hydroxy and ester functional groups in its molecular composition plays a significant role in determining its solubility in various solvents.

Key points regarding its solubility:

  • Hydrophilic Nature: The hydroxy group (-OH) increases the compound's affinity for water, leading to enhanced solubility in polar solvents.
  • Hydrophobic Tendency: The long hydrocarbon chain (octadec-9-enoate) introduces hydrophobic properties, which can limit its solubility in water, making it more soluble in non-polar solvents like oils and organic solvents.
  • Solvent Interaction: This compound is likely to exhibit better solubility in solvents such as ethanol and acetone due to favorable interactions.

Synonyms
2-hydroxypropyl octadec-9-enoate
Propylene glycol monooleate
